Gout Attack Over? Understand to Break the Cycle
So, a gout episode has finally stopped? That’s great! But simply treating the immediate pain isn't sufficient to prevent another ones. The vital to actively address the root factor and disrupt the painful cycle. Here’s how:
- Nutrition adjustments: Limit high-uric acid foods like shellfish and beer.
- Staying hydrated: Consume ample liquids daily to aid flush out uric acid.
- Treatment adherence: Follow your healthcare provider's prescribed plan consistently.
- Regular monitoring: Collaborate with the doctor to monitor blood levels and modify treatment appropriately.
By implementing these measures, you can significantly lower the risk of another uric acid flare.
